[Chicago] Brazil After its Presidential Election: Beyond Neo-Fascism and Neo-Liberalism?

The recent presidential election in Brazil marks a possible turn to the Left, following the pattern in earlier elections in Colombia, Chile, and Honduras. How significant is this shift and what challenges does it pose to the labor, women’s liberation, LGBTQ, and anti-racist movements in Brazil?

Opening the Discussion: Rodrigo M.R. Pinho, Sao Paulo, Brazil
